Renovation Framing in Conroe, TX
Renovation framing services involve constructing the structural framework that supports interior and exterior modifications within a property. This service covers a variety of projects, including creating new walls, opening up existing spaces, adding room extensions, or modifying layouts to better suit changing needs. Property owners often seek framing services when undertaking home remodels, basement finishing, or converting spaces such as garages into livable areas, ensuring that the new structures are built to support the intended design and function.
Before requesting renovation framing, homeowners should consider the scope of their project, including the desired layout changes and any load-bearing requirements. It’s important to understand the existing structure’s condition and whether additional support or reinforcements are necessary. Clarifying project goals and reviewing plans with a professional can help ensure the framing work aligns with building codes and safety standards, providing a solid foundation for successful renovation outcomes.

Common Renovation Framing Jobs
Interior Wall Framing - creates the structural framework for new or remodeled interior walls.
Exterior Wall Framing - provides support and shape for building facades and exterior structures.
Room Additions - forms the foundation and framing for expanding living spaces.
Basement Framing - establishes the framework for basement finishing or remodeling projects.
Kitchen and Bathroom Framing - prepares the structure for installing cabinets, fixtures, and finishes.
Custom Framing Projects - supports unique design features and architectural details.
Renovation Framing Questions
What is renovation framing? Renovation framing involves updating or modifying existing wall structures to prepare for interior changes or additions in a property.
What types of projects require renovation framing? Projects like room additions, basement finishing, or interior remodels often need renovation framing to support new layouts.
Why is proper framing important in renovations? Proper framing ensures structural stability and provides a solid foundation for finishes and fixtures in the renovated space.
What materials are used in renovation framing? Common materials include wood studs and metal framing, selected based on the project’s needs and building codes.
